I normally use Attacking.
Why? First of all. I am not sure how the bonuses work. But I believe they increase certain abilities for the players. Like if you activate attacking and have 10% bonus, a player that you have with 100 in shooting will get 115 instead. Attacking is my team's best ability. If my understanding of how the bonus works is correct, my team would get the biggest gain overall from activating the attack bonus. Like, if I have 150 in attacking 125 in conditioning and 100 in defense, 5% more in attack gives me an overall game of 0.05x150=7.5, in conditioning 0.05x125=6.25 and in defense 0.05x100=5. The 7.5 gain in attacking I would get is 2.5 higher than the gain I would get from defense, could be somewhat significant.
OTOH, I realize this might be more complexed as I am writing this. Again, why? How does the Fitness ability work? Let's say a player have 100% in the ability Fitness, he has 80% in Condition after some training. What impact does that have? I think it's reasonable to assume that the Condition of a player with some kind of factor affects -- all -- abilities. Like I have no clue about what the factor actually is, doubt it's 1:1 (like that a player that shoots 100 only will shoot 100*0.8 if his Condition is at 80%), but something like that. Its also reasonable to assume that a player with high ability fitness will loose less conditioning during a game. Right? Will a player with 150% in Fitness maybe loose half the Conditon during a game compared to a player with 100% Fitness? I am going to do some tests with this. Anyway, what I am getting at is that if this is the result -- using the Condition Bonus would give 5% bonus to fitness, higher fitness decreases the Condition loss, which would have a positive affect on -- all -- abilities. Ie there would be a cumulative gain from activating conditioning. I think I am going to start trying that more!
